Nittany Lion Inn Seeks Lobby Artwork Proposals
Artists have a chance to leave their mark on one of Penn State’s most beloved
landmarks, The Nittany Lion Inn, and receive $10,000 in the process. As part
of the Inn’s latest renovations, Penn State is sponsoring a national competition
to select a painting or bas-relief for installation in its highly traveled
lobby.

Elm Watch
University Park’s towering elm trees—one of the country's nicest stands of American elms—are as familiar to Penn Staters as Joe Paterno and ice cream.
But a deadly disease could eliminate the stately elms from campus in just
a few years. Penn State researchers, arborists, and landscape planners are
in a race to save the trees.
